diff --git a/synology_dsm/api/surveillance_station/__init__.py b/synology_dsm/api/surveillance_station/__init__.py index 047284de..db0823f8 100644 --- a/synology_dsm/api/surveillance_station/__init__.py +++ b/synology_dsm/api/surveillance_station/__init__.py @@ -37,6 +37,9 @@ def update(self): )["data"] ) + if not self._cameras_by_id: + return + live_view_datas = self._dsm.get( self.CAMERA_API_KEY, "GetLiveViewPath",